Commercial Alert December 13, 2001
Following is Commercial Alert's statement about the U.S. Surgeon
General's report on obesity, which was released today.
"It's good that the Surgeon General wants schools to restrict students'
access to vending machines and school stores that sell junk food. But
this is not enough."
"Schools should cease serving as dispensaries of pathology for our
nation's children, period. That means no more advertising of junk food
in the schools."
"In particular, Federal and state government should prohibit Coca-Cola
and PepsiCo from using the schools to market junk food to children. And
Channel One should be banned from schools across the country, because it
aggressively promotes junk food and soda pop to captive audiences of
school children."
"The federal government is a prime culprit here. It subsidizes the
manipulation of the nation's children, and the undermining of their
health, through tax deductions for advertising aimed at them. These
taxpayer subsidies help undermine the authority of parents. They promote
obesity and other health problems, which create enormous financial
burdens for our nation."
